#08d02d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#08d02d is composed of 3.1% red, 81.6%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.4%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 131.1 degrees, a saturation of 92.6% and a lightness of 42.4%. #08d02d color hex could be obtained by blending #10ff5a with #00a100.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#08d02d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#08d02d has RGB values of R:8, G:208,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 577581.

Shades and Tints of #08d02d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#ecfef0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#08d02d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6c6c is the less saturated color, while #08d02d is the most saturated one.
